Image license includes the Image-Group, file formats and size variations.
BCH_059100_S_A22_11415284
1 / 2
A row of large solar panels stands against a backdrop of grass and dirt, under a clear blue sky. This state-of-the-art solar plant showcases the engineering and technology behind sustainable energy in Spain.